One Way
Lowest Fare Finder Chrome Extension

Popular Filters

One Way Price

AED 2,846 AED 4,300

Duration

9 h 25 m 23 h 30 m

Stops From Riga

Departure From Riga

6 AM - 12 PM

AED 2,846

12 PM - 6 PM

AED 2,846

Arrival at Shetland Islands

6 AM - 12 PM

AED 2,846

12 PM - 6 PM

AED 2,846

After 6 PM

AED 3,096

Alliances & Airlines

Oneworld

(14)

SkyTeam

(16)

Star Alliance

()

Layover Airports

Layover Duration

4 h 30 m 18 h 30 m

Riga to Shetland Islands Flight Schedule

Planning your travel has never been easier. Get updated flight schedules for various airlines between Riga to Shetland Islands on MakeMyTrip. We offer the cheapest airfares across all major airlines. You can book your Riga to Shetland Islands Flight at best price and can also check Shetland Islands to Riga Flight Schedule for your return journey online. Take advantage of amazing offers for your flights only at Makemytrip. Get Up To AED 150 OFF* on your flight booking with MakeMyTrip using coupon code : “FLYAE”. 100% Refund on Flight cancellations with MMT Zero Cancellation.

Sorted By:
Departure
Duration
Arrival
Price
British Airways

AED 2,890

AED 2,846

FLYAE coupon applied

Riga to Shetland Islands , 17 Jun

British Airways BA | 2241 | Operated By Air Baltic

07:25

Tue, 17 Jun 25

Riga, Latvia

02 h 50 m

08:15

Tue, 17 Jun 25

Terminal S

London - Gatwick Apt,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 1310

12:15

Tue, 17 Jun 25

Terminal T5

London - Heathrow Apt, United Kingdom

01 h 35 m

13:50

Tue, 17 Jun 25

Aberdeen,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 4078 | Operated By Loganair Limited

14:45

Tue, 17 Jun 25

Aberdeen, United Kingdom

01 h 05 m

15:50

Tue, 17 Jun 25

Shetland Islands,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

FARES
Cabin bagCheck-inCancellationDate ChangeMeal

Plus

Fare offered by airline.

7 kg
23 kg (1 Pc.)
Non-refundable fare
Date Change Fee starting
AED 300
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 2,890AED 2,846

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
No airline cancellation fee
Free date change allowed
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 4,480AED 4,436

British Airways

AED 2,900

AED 2,856

FLYAE coupon applied

Riga to Shetland Islands , 17 Jun

British Airways BA | 2243 | Operated By Air Baltic

15:40

Tue, 17 Jun 25

Riga, Latvia

02 h 50 m

16:30

Tue, 17 Jun 25

Terminal S

London - Gatwick Apt,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 1450

20:05

Tue, 17 Jun 25

Terminal T5

London - Heathrow Apt, United Kingdom

01 h 20 m

21:25

Tue, 17 Jun 25

Edinburgh,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 4093 | Operated By Loganair Limited

06:50

Wed, 18 Jun 25

Edinburgh, United Kingdom

01 h 25 m

08:15

Wed, 18 Jun 25

Shetland Islands,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

FARES
Cabin bagCheck-inCancellationDate ChangeMeal

Plus

Fare offered by airline.

7 kg
23 kg (1 Pc.)
Non-refundable fare
Date Change Fee starting
AED 300
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 2,900AED 2,856

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
No airline cancellation fee
Free date change allowed
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 4,490AED 4,446

British Airways

AED 3,140

AED 3,096

FLYAE coupon applied

Riga to Shetland Islands , 17 Jun

British Airways BA | 2241 | Operated By Air Baltic

07:25

Tue, 17 Jun 25

Riga, Latvia

02 h 50 m

08:15

Tue, 17 Jun 25

Terminal S

London - Gatwick Apt,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 1310

12:15

Tue, 17 Jun 25

Terminal T5

London - Heathrow Apt, United Kingdom

01 h 35 m

13:50

Tue, 17 Jun 25

Aberdeen,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 4063 | Operated By Loganair Limited

18:10

Tue, 17 Jun 25

Aberdeen, United Kingdom

01 h 05 m

19:15

Tue, 17 Jun 25

Shetland Islands,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

FARES
Cabin bagCheck-inCancellationDate ChangeMeal

PLUS|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
Non-refundable fare
Date Change Fee starting
AED 260
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 3,140AED 3,096

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
No airline cancellation fee
Free date change allowed
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 4,480AED 4,436

British Airways

AED 3,150

AED 3,106

FLYAE coupon applied

Riga to Shetland Islands , 17 Jun

British Airways BA | 2241 | Operated By Air Baltic

07:25

Tue, 17 Jun 25

Riga, Latvia

02 h 50 m

08:15

Tue, 17 Jun 25

Terminal S

London - Gatwick Apt,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 1442

11:55

Tue, 17 Jun 25

Terminal T5

London - Heathrow Apt, United Kingdom

01 h 25 m

13:20

Tue, 17 Jun 25

Edinburgh,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 4097 | Operated By Loganair Limited

16:45

Tue, 17 Jun 25

Edinburgh, United Kingdom

01 h 25 m

18:10

Tue, 17 Jun 25

Shetland Islands,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

FARES
Cabin bagCheck-inCancellationDate ChangeMeal

PLUS|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
Non-refundable fare
Date Change Fee starting
AED 260
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 3,150AED 3,106

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
No airline cancellation fee
Free date change allowed
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 4,490AED 4,446

British Airways

More Timing Options

AED 3,170

AED 3,126

FLYAE coupon applied

Riga to Shetland Islands , 17 Jun

British Airways BA | 2243 | Operated By Air Baltic

15:40

Tue, 17 Jun 25

Riga, Latvia

02 h 50 m

16:30

Tue, 17 Jun 25

Terminal S

London - Gatwick Apt,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 1498

20:15

Tue, 17 Jun 25

Terminal T5

London - Heathrow Apt, United Kingdom

01 h 25 m

21:40

Tue, 17 Jun 25

Terminal M

Glasgow,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

British Airways BA | 4017 | Operated By Loganair Limited

10:15

Wed, 18 Jun 25

Terminal M

Glasgow, United Kingdom

01 h 30 m

11:45

Wed, 18 Jun 25

Shetland Islands, United Kingdom

BAGGAGE : CHECK INCABIN

Information not available

FARES
Cabin bagCheck-inCancellationDate ChangeMeal

PLUS|Economy Standard

Fare offered by airline.

7 kg
23 kg (1 Pc.)
Non-refundable fare
Date Change Fee starting
AED 260
Complimentary meals (No meal will be served if flight duration is less than 2 hours)

AED 3,170AED 3,126

Hide

More Deals For You!

More discounts for your flight

Get FLAT

12% OFF

MMTWELCOME

Grab Up to AED 90 OFF
*Applicable for First times user only.

Get Up To

20% OFF

FLYSUPER

Grab Up to AED 120 OFF
*T&C Applied

Get Up To

AED 150 OFF*

FLYAE

BIG Offer on Flights!
*T&C Applied

Show